Product Description
Holy kustom kars Batman! Crazy creations designed and built by George Barris for movies and TV are brought to life in this book. See them all - the Flintmobile, the Munster's Coach, the Batmobile, the Beverly Hillbillys' jalopy and more of the best customs ever to hit Hollywood. Fetherston reveals how each vehicle was built and provides an outline of each movie/TV show and the car related to the story.

4 out of 5 stars A good overview but a few cars are missing.   February 16, 1999
 4 out of 4 found this review helpful

Great coverage of TV's Batmobile and the Munter's cars. Authors also remind you about cars you didn't know Barris did: The Beverly Hillbillies truck, the Flintstones (film of course) cars, updates of the Knight Rider Firebird, the Jurassic Park Explorers, and the infamous sitcom "My Mother the Car" (the butt of many Johnny Carson jokes). But also taking up space are forgotten cars from forgotton projects...the Bugaloos dune buggy and a TV special "Romp". Cars I would have liked to have seen but didn't make the cut include the Monkee Mobile, the Green Hornet's "Black Beauty" and the Stutz replicas made for the TV adventure series "Bearcats!". Overall a good book, but I have a hunch that only the surface of Barris' career has been scratched. How about a large format book with lots of color and details on the surviving movie cars and "Kustoms" that made Barris the legend he is?
